Finally, the popularity of the programme might hinge on its subsumation of explicit empowerment targets. Support of the group for the programme may be derived from the idea that training makes women better wives and moms, not more empowered folks (32). A variety of critics argue that, if empowerment had been the explicit objective, fewer households would maintain their daughters in class (16,32). For the strategic purpose of gaining and sustaining community assist and political viability, the programme directors restrain from disrupting gender norms. Most governments prohibit recruiters from charging migrant staff recruitment charges – Bangladesh allows licensed recruiters to cost up to 20,000 BDT (259 USD). Most governments require employers to conform to monthly minimum salaries – Bangladesh has one of the lowest at about sixteen,000 BDT which is 200 USD, compared to the Philippines’ 400 USD. Also, most embassies within the Middle East present shelter to home workers who flee abusive employers while Bangladeshi embassies do not.

According to the Bangladeshi NGO, BRAC, about 1,300 female employees fled Saudi Arabia in 2018 due to abuse and exploitation. The Ministry of Expatriates Welfare and Overseas Employment (EWOE) interviewed 111 ladies who returned to Bangladesh in August 2019. Their testimonies revealed that 35 p.c of returnees had left because of sexual and physical abuse. Other causes included food and relaxation deprivation, denial of sick leave, and withholding of salaries. The Bank has been a long-time partner, offering financing and technical help to help Bangladesh enhance its social protection and jobs applications. Since 2006, IDA has been supporting a nationwide program that augments the government’s block grants provided to all 4,561 Union Parishads (the lowest tier of elected native government). The block grant enables Union Parishads to determine and spend on native priorities.
